                                      The C-130J once had 8 blade contra-rotating propellers; are they no longer used?

                                      thanks, Bob

                                      1 Reply Last reply Reply Quote 0
                                      • D Offline
                                        dolphus
                                        last edited by

                                        bob-designer I found the following in.....
                                        http://www.theaviationzone.com
                                        Engines - The C-130J is equipped with four Allison AE2100D3 turboprop engines each rated at 4,591 shaft horsepower (3,425 kW). The all-composite six-blade R391 propeller system was developed by Dowty Aerospace. The engines are equipped with full authority digital electronic control (FADEC) by Lucas Aerospace. An automatic thrust control system (ATCS) optimizes the balance of power on the engines allowing lower values of minimum control speeds and superior short-airfield performance.

                                        http://i458.photobucket.com/albums/qq304/dolphus_006/six-bladeR391propeller.jpg

                                        I don't think the C-130 ever had contra rotating props
